BATON
ROUGE, LA – Attorney General Jeff Landry
announced his office has extradited a
Jefferson Parish man to face Internet Crimes Against Children charges.
Timothy
Becnel, 53 of Marrero, was arrested on September
30, 2020 in Grove City, Ohio and booked into the Franklin County Jail as
a fugitive from Jefferson Parish. He was
recently extradited back to Louisiana by the Louisiana Bureau of Investigation
and charged with 60 counts of Pornography Involving
Juveniles Under the Age of Thirteen (possession).
The arrest was a result of a joint investigation with the
Louisiana Bureau of Investigation, Jefferson Parish Sheriff's Office, Homeland
Security Investigations, and Grove City (OH) Police
Department.
